If you notice your cat’s eyes watering, you should consider whether they need to see a vet. any cat that is crying tears should see a vet within the next 12 hours – many eye conditions that cause tear production can result in blindness if left untreated. on the other hand, if your cat is yowling, you should consider any other possible symptoms.

Stress. behavior problems are probably the most common cause of excessive meowing in cats. look for ways to remove stress from your cat’s life (e.g. for indoor cats especially, make your home more cat friendly, with cat furniture like cat trees). introduce new pets carefully (e.g. using scent swapping) to minimize stress. A cat crying at the door is a common scenario, sometimes explained by the heat cycle or desire to mate. they cry due to a desire to get out and meet other cats. however, there are other possible reasons a cat might cry at the door: if a cat is accustomed to going outside, it is normal for them to cry to either let them in or out.
